PECA Amendment Bill
Q1. What does PECA stand for in the context of Pakistan’s legislation?
A) Pakistan Election Commission Act
B) Prevention of Electronic Crimes Act
C) Public Education Commission Act
D) Protection of Economic Crimes Act
Answer: B) Prevention of Electronic Crimes Act
Explanation: The Prevention of Electronic Crimes Act (PECA) is legislation aimed at tackling cybercrimes, including online harassment and defamation. Recent amendments have sparked criticism from journalists and rights groups for allegedly curbing press freedom.
Pakistan-China Relations
Q2. What is the primary objective of the China-Pakistan Economic Corridor (CPEC)?
A) Military cooperation between China and Pakistan
B) Strengthening economic ties through infrastructure projects
C) Promoting cultural exchange between the two nations
D) Enhancing China’s influence in South Asia
Answer: B) Strengthening economic ties through infrastructure projects
Explanation: CPEC focuses on infrastructure development, including roads, ports, and energy projects, to boost economic cooperation between China and Pakistan. It is a flagship project of China’s Belt and Road Initiative.
